Communication is the key to maintaining healthy and fulfilling relationships, whether they be with our partners, family members, friends, or colleagues. One powerful technique that can enhance our relationships is mindful communication. Mindful communication involves being fully present and engaged in our interactions with others, listening and responding with awareness and compassion. By practicing mindful communication, we can strengthen our connections with others, improve our understanding and empathy, and resolve conflicts more effectively.
One important aspect of mindful communication is being aware of our own thoughts, feelings, and reactions during conversations. By taking the time to check in with ourselves and acknowledge our own emotions, we can respond more skillfully and compassionately to others. This self-awareness can prevent us from reacting impulsively or defensively, allowing us to communicate more thoughtfully and empathetically.
Another key component of mindful communication is active listening. Instead of simply waiting for our turn to speak, we can focus completely on the speaker, paying attention to their words, tone, and body language. By listening attentively, we can demonstrate respect and understanding, show empathy, and develop deeper connections with others. Active listening also helps us to avoid misunderstandings and conflict by ensuring that we fully comprehend the perspectives and feelings of the other person.
In addition to self-awareness and active listening, mindfulness can also help us to respond to challenging situations with calm and clarity. When we encounter disagreements or conflicts in our relationships, we can use mindfulness techniques to regulate our emotions, stay present in the moment, and choose our words and actions thoughtfully. By approaching difficult conversations with calmness and compassion, we can foster understanding, find common ground, and reach resolutions that benefit all parties involved.
